The Role of Ceramic Powder Milling Machines in the Manufacturing Industry
The ceramic industry is a crucial sector in many industries, including construction, electronics, and automotive. One of the key processes used in this industry is the production of ceramic powders. These powders are then mixed with other materials to form ceramic bodies, which are used in various applications. In order to produce high-quality ceramic powders, it is essential to use specialized equipment, such as ceramic powder milling machines.
Ceramic powder milling machines are designed to grind and mix ceramic powders into a finer consistency. These machines are highly efficient and can handle large quantities of powder at once. They are also capable of producing a wide range of particle sizes, which is important for the final product's performance.
The process of using ceramic powder milling machines involves feeding the raw powder into the machine, which then rotates at high speeds to break down the particles. This process is known as milling, and it produces a finer powder that is easier to handle and work with. The resulting powder is then collected and stored for future use.
In addition to their role in producing high-quality ceramic powders, ceramic powder milling machines are also used in other industries. For example, they are used in the production of glass, metallurgy, and even in the manufacture of plastics. The ability to produce high-quality ceramic powders has made these machines an essential tool in the manufacturing industry.
